When you call for a chimney repair estimate, several variables influence the total. The height of your chimney and how easily we can reach the roof play a big part. The specific materials needed—whether it’s custom brick matching, stainless steel liners, or specialized mortar—also affect your final bill. If there is hidden internal damage like crumbling flue tiles or structural shifting, that requires more labor and specialized equipment than a simple exterior patch. We always evaluate the extent of the wear and tear to give you a clear picture of what’s needed to keep your home safe.

Chimney cap repair companies in Austin focus on fixing or replacing damaged caps. The cap protects your chimney from rain, animals, and debris. If it's loose, bent, or rusted, it needs attention. Pros ensure the cap is securely fitted and provides effective protection for your Austin home.
Chimney brick repair needs in Austin often arise from weather exposure and age. Freeze-thaw cycles, though less severe than in colder climates, can still cause damage. Mortar can deteriorate, leading to loose bricks. Regular inspections help catch these issues early. Prompt repair maintains the chimney's integrity.
Chimney crown repair companies in Austin repair crowns by sealing cracks and reinforcing them. The crown is the concrete slab on top of the chimney. It shields the masonry from water. Pros ensure it's properly sealed to prevent water penetration, a common issue in areas like Austin.
The process for chimney liner repair in Austin usually involves inspecting the existing liner for cracks or damage. If compromised, the old liner might be removed and replaced, or a new liner system installed. This is crucial for safety and preventing heat transfer to the home's structure.
